The Rise of XPS Foam Board in the Global Market

The building and construction industry is under immense pressure to deliver high-performance, energy-efficient structures that meet global environmental standards. XPS foam board fits this demand perfectly. Known for its closed-cell structure, XPS offers superior thermal insulation, compressive strength, and moisture resistance—essential qualities in both residential and industrial applications.

According to market trends, demand for XPS foam insulation is driven by:

  • Growing focus on green buildings and energy conservation.

  • Increased awareness of long-term energy cost savings.

  • Governmental regulations mandating higher thermal performance in new constructions.

As a result, architects, developers, and contractors are turning to XPS foam board as their insulation material of choice, making it a staple in walls, roofs, and foundations.


What Makes XPS Foam Board Superior?

Compared to traditional materials like EPS (expanded polystyrene) or fiberglass, XPS delivers a unique combination of performance benefits:

FeatureXPS Foam BoardEPS / Fiberglass
Thermal ConductivityLower (better insulation)Higher
Water AbsorptionVery low (closed-cell structure)Moderate to high
Compressive StrengthExcellent for load-bearing structuresLower
Aging ResistanceHigh durability, retains performanceMay degrade over time
InstallationLightweight and easy to handleVaries
XPS is particularly suited for below-grade and roof insulation where high compressive strength and moisture resistance are critical. Its non-toxic, soft yet sturdy nature also makes it ideal for applications requiring cushioning, soundproofing, or shock absorption.
